Paver Walkway Installation in Fairfield County, CT

Paver walkway installation involves creating durable, attractive pathways using interlocking pavers made from materials such as concrete, brick, or stone. This service covers a variety of projects, including front entrances, backyard paths, garden walkways, and side yard routes. Homeowners typically seek these installations to enhance curb appeal, improve accessibility, or define specific areas within their outdoor spaces. Before requesting a paver walkway, property owners often want to understand the available paver styles, color options, and the overall design that complements their property’s aesthetic, as well as the estimated lifespan and maintenance needs of the chosen materials.

Understanding the scope of a paver walkway project also includes considerations like site preparation, drainage, and the desired width and layout of the pathway. Property owners usually want to clarify the installation process, including how the base is prepared to ensure stability and longevity, and whether any grading or excavation is necessary. Having clear information about these aspects helps ensure the project aligns with their expectations and results in a functional, visually appealing walkway that withstands foot traffic and weather conditions over time.

Paver Walkway Installation Questions

What types of materials are used for paver walkways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, offering durability and aesthetic appeal.

Can paver walkways be installed on uneven ground? Yes, proper grading and base preparation can ensure a stable and level walkway on uneven terrain.

Are paver walkways su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, pavers are designed to withstand frequent foot traffic and are easy to repair if needed.

What maintenance is required for paver walkways?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ain appearance and longevity.
